Reaction: AgNO3 + NaCl -> AgCI + NaNO3 (+ K2CrO4 )
Standardization of silver nitrate
Weight of sodium chloride used (g)
0.0884g
Titration trial 1
8.8ml
Titration trial 2
8.7ml
Titration trial 3
9.0ml
The sodium chloride is weighed and dissolve to make up to 100.0ml (~0.015M). Then
10.0 ml this standard sodium chloride solution is pipetted to concial flask and the
volume of silver nitrate solution is tabulated in the above table
Mohr titration results
Volume of silver nitrate used
Titration trial 1
11.9ml
Titration trial2
12.2ml
Titration trial3
12.1ml
Calculate the concentration of the AgNo3, the concentration of NaCl in the sample
solution and the potato chip, the sodium and salt content in sample (mg/100g)
